Abstract

This paper presents an approach to obtain high torque density in induction motor (IM) design by optimizing the search algorithms and processes. Optimal design of electrical machines has many sub-optimal peaks and requires significant computation time. To solve this problem, this paper proposes a new cost pattern value method (CPVM) for local search algorithms employed in optimal design. The CPVM concept is an intelligent strategy that digitizes the gradient over the searching region by sharing information between neighboring points. When the algorithm converges quickly to local optimum by a normalized weight method, it provides a mechanism to escape from that region. The validity of the proposed approach was evaluated using a benchmark function, and it was applied to optimal design of a 260 kW IM to maximize torque production based on a finite-element analysis. For better accuracy, we employ slip-frequency analysis compatible with vector control for an IM numerical analysis. [ABSTRACT FROM AUTHOR]
